The Downtown Dayton Partnership recognizes the need in our small business community to develop new, creative ways to help sustain them through the COVID-19 pandemic. In collaboration with the CareSource Foundation, the Dayton Area Chamber of Commerce, and CityWide Development Corp., we have created a special funding program for our consumer businesses. The Re-Open Downtown Dayton Fund will provide small grants to help cover operating expenses and provide bridge / gap assistance to downtown's locally owned consumer businesses that plan to return to operations following this crisis.
Program Highlights
The application deadline to apply was May 22, 2020 at 5pm EDT. Applications are being considered on their merit by a selection committee made up of downtown business leaders. This is NOT a first-come, first-served grant. The fund will be administered by the Dayton Area Chamber of Commerce Education and Public Improvement (EPI) Foundation.
